This formatting template compares two dates (start_date and end_date). If the dates are the same, it displays the single date; otherwise, it displays a range in the format "December 7, 2024 - December 9, 2024".
Usage
It is meant to be used with variables, like {{{start_date}}}:
{{Date comparison | start_date={{{start_date|}}} | end_date = {{{end_date|}}}}}
Examples
The following examples use hard-coded dates, for examples sake.
{{Date comparison | start_date = 2024/12/07 | end_date = 2024/12/07}}
{{Date comparison | start_date = 2024/12/07 | end_date = 2024/12/09}}
